How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sterling?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heap Sterling Studio Apartments | $2,038 | $1,738 | $2,639 |
| Cheap Sterling 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,004 | $1,450 | $2,898 |
| Cheap Sterling 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,619 | $1,898 | $3,772 |
| Cheap Sterling 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,450 | $2,384 | $4,933 |

Cheapest Neighborhoods for Apartments in Sterling, VA
Pricing Updated: 12/15/2025Current apartment rentals in the Sterling, VA area range in price from $1,450 to $5,205 with an overall median price of $3,564. The three Sterling neighborhoods with the lowest median rent pricing are Countryside at $1,450, Countryside Potomac Falls at $1,450, and Dulles Town Center at $1,450. Here is today’s list of the top 10 neighborhoods with the lowest median pricing for Sterling Apartments for rent:
| Neighborhood | Median Price | Min Price | Available Units |
|---|---|---|---|
| Countryside | $3,216 | $1,450 | 94 |
| Countryside Potomac Falls | $3,216 | $1,450 | 96 |
| Dulles Town Center | $3,216 | $1,450 | 108 |
| Potomac Falls | $3,216 | $1,450 | 99 |
| Staverton West | $3,510 | $1,450 | 223 |
| Richland Forest | $3,535 | $1,450 | 87 |
| Grovewood | $3,590 | $1,545 | 338 |
| Dominion Station | $3,595 | $1,545 | 100 |
| Outer Ashburn Sterling | $3,595 | $1,545 | 139 |
| Steeplechase | $3,595 | $1,450 | 109 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
